- Introduction – The purpose of this document is to explain If user (approver) unable to complete an assigned tasks (SAP MDG CR Action) due availability, then the user has to impersonate own role to another user for a stipulated period of time.
- Overview – SAP Master Data Governance provide standard Substitution Button in Workflow Inbox: This is a standard workflow administration functionality. When people impersonates, they should set substitution.
- Scenario This document will help you to fulfill the business need i.e. if user is not available to action then he/she can delegate his responsibility to someone to take action on respective MDG CR so that business shouldn’t be effected.
- Prerequisites Create new rule with below details : Substitution ID (user-id) / From-To date.
- Process
In case of a planned delegation user can create a substitution rule.Within the rule definition, ‘Substitute’s ID’, ‘From Date’ and ‘To Date’ can be given.As per the rule, substitute will be able to process workflow items of the user for the given period of time.

Fill-in type of Substitution: If you are unexpectedly absent, the assignee can take over your tasks completely.Email Alert Notification to Supervisor and Substitute: This can be catered by Background Job Scheduling. A custom program will execute every minute in the background to check all the CRs which are pending for approver’s action since 15 mins or more and send an email notificationEvery user should create a substitution rule selection option “Fill In for Me”
The rule can be turned off/on anytime by the user
Substitute user can see the rules involving him/her in the second table of substitute window.
By clicking on ‘Take Over’ button, substitute user will receive the pending CRs of the user and hence can take action on the CRs which are nearing SLA.
